Ebro 155E Production








Manufacturer:
Manufacturer: Ebro
Factory: Spain


Ebro 155E Electrical










Charging system: alternator
Battery volts: 12
Battery AH: 12

Ebro 155E Mechanical


















Chassis: 4×2 2WD
Steering: manual
Brakes: wet disc
Cab: Open operator station.
Transmission: 6-speed gear

Capacity







Fuel: 17.2 gal
65.1 L
Hydraulic system: 10.6 gal
40.1 L

Hydraulics




Capacity: 10.6 gal
40.1 L

Tracktor Hitch




Rear Type: II

Power Take-off (PTO)







Rear RPM: 540 (1.375)
Engine RPM: 549@1620

Ebro 155E Engine detail


































Engine Detail
Ebro
diesel
4-cylinder
liquid-cooled
Displacement: 220.3 ci
3.6 L
Power: 55 hp
41.0 kW
Air cleaner: oil bath
Compression: 16.5:1
Rated RPM: 1800
Starter volts: 12
Oil capacity: 7.2 qts
6.8 L
Coolant capacity: 15.9 qts
15.0 L



Ebro 155E Transmission overview

Engine Oil









Type: gear
Gears: 6 forward and 2 reverse
Clutch: 279mm dry disc

Ebro 155E Dimensions






















Length: 130.7 inches
331 cm
Width: 79.5 inches
201 cm
Height (steering wheel): 65 inches
165 cm
Weight: 5071 lbs
2300 kg
Ground clearance: 15.8 inches
40 cm
Front tread: 50 to 73.6 inches
127 to 186 cm
Rear tread: 52 to 72.1 inches
132 to 183 cm
